summaryrefslogtreecommitdiffstats
path: root/target/x86/syslinux/syslinux.mk
diff options
context:
space:
mode:
authorBernhard Reutner-Fischer2007-02-04 17:34:56 +0100
committerBernhard Reutner-Fischer2007-02-04 17:34:56 +0100
commit3c1f00b21a11a861ffee0ef801dc57b50b0639c1 (patch)
tree00c2393e0c177dd2dc4eec833ca30b8d5b818488 /target/x86/syslinux/syslinux.mk
parent- propagate BR2_ARM_EABI setting down to LINUX26_KCONFIG (diff)
downloadbuildroot-3c1f00b21a11a861ffee0ef801dc57b50b0639c1.tar.gz
buildroot-3c1f00b21a11a861ffee0ef801dc57b50b0639c1.tar.xz
buildroot-3c1f00b21a11a861ffee0ef801dc57b50b0639c1.zip
- avoid spurious rebuilds. Thanks to janlana, closes #1191
- provide a syslinux-source target while at it
Diffstat (limited to 'target/x86/syslinux/syslinux.mk')
-rw-r--r--target/x86/syslinux/syslinux.mk6
1 files changed, 4 insertions, 2 deletions
diff --git a/target/x86/syslinux/syslinux.mk b/target/x86/syslinux/syslinux.mk
index 8d6d1e168..a1f5d7f8e 100644
--- a/target/x86/syslinux/syslinux.mk
+++ b/target/x86/syslinux/syslinux.mk
@@ -34,14 +34,16 @@ SYSLINUX_BIN=$(SYSLINUX_DIR2)/mtools/syslinux
$(DL_DIR)/$(SYSLINUX_SOURCE):
$(WGET) -P $(DL_DIR) $(SYSLINUX_SITE)/$(SYSLINUX_SOURCE)
+syslinux-source: $(DL_DIR)/$(SYSLINUX_SOURCE)
+
$(SYSLINUX_DIR)/Makefile: $(DL_DIR)/$(SYSLINUX_SOURCE) $(SYSLINUX_PATCH)
$(SYSLINUX_CAT) $(DL_DIR)/$(SYSLINUX_SOURCE) | tar -C $(BUILD_DIR) -xvf -
toolchain/patch-kernel.sh $(SYSLINUX_DIR) target/x86/syslinux/ \*.patch
- touch -c $(SYSLINUX_DIR)/Makefile
+ touch -c $@
$(SYSLINUX_DIR)/isolinux.bin: $(SYSLINUX_DIR)/Makefile
$(MAKE) -C $(SYSLINUX_DIR)
- touch -c $(SYSLINUX_DIR)/isolinux.bin
+ touch -c $@
syslinux: $(SYSLINUX_DIR)/isolinux.bin